Regional visionaries were honored at the CMEx Caribbean Leadership Awards 2024

MIAMI (Dec. 22, 2024) – The CMEx Caribbean Leadership Awards 2024, held on December 8, 2024, at the Loews Coral Gables Hotel in Miami, brought together leaders in tourism, media, and sustainable development for a night of celebration and collaboration. The event highlighted the achievements of the region’s most influential figures while raising funds to support vital educational initiatives. By fostering meaningful exchanges and recognizing trailblazing contributions, the CMEx Caribbean Leadership Awards 2024 underscored the importance of unity and collaboration in advancing Caribbean tourism and sustainable growth.

Honoring Caribbean Visionaries

The CMEx Caribbean Leadership Awards 2024 honored a distinguished group of individuals for their outstanding contributions to tourism, media, and sustainable development:

  • Kashmie Ali – Vice President of Sales and Marketing, Sailrock South Caicos
  • Tracy Berkeley – CEO, Bermuda Tourism Authority
  • Latia Duncombe – Director General, Bahamas Ministry of Tourism, Investments and Aviation
  • Laura Dowrich-Phillips – Caribbean Journalist and Public Relations Manager, Experience Turks and Caicos
  • Ambassador Victor Fernandes – Veteran Caribbean Broadcaster and Barbados Ambassador to the United States and the Organization of American States
  • Gloria and Solomon Herbert – Co-founders of Black Meetings & Tourism magazine
  • Dr. Lisa Indar – Interim Executive Director, Caribbean Public Health Agency (CARPHA)
  • Eroline and Lyton Lamontagne – Owners, Fond Doux Eco Resort, St. Lucia
  • Thea LaFond – 2024 Olympic Champion, Dominica
  • Vanessa Ledesma – CEO, Caribbean Hotel and Tourism Association (CHTA)
  • Marc Melville – CEO, Chukka Caribbean Adventures
  • Marie McKenzie – Senior Vice President of Government and Destination Affairs, Carnival Corporation & plc
  • Jennifer Nugent-Hill – Director of Government and Community Affairs, Tropical Shipping
  • Simón Suárez – Vice President, Grupo Puntacana
  • Ellison “Tommy” Thompson – Former Deputy Director General of Tourism, Bahamas, and Former CEO, St. Kitts Tourism Authority
  • Christine Valls – Director of Sales for Latin America and the Caribbean, United Airlines

Supported by Caribbean Excellence

The event was backed by a stellar lineup of partners committed to Caribbean tourism and development. These included:

  • Anse Chastanet and Jade Mountain, St. Lucia
  • Bucuti & Tara Beach Resort, Aruba
  • Ladera Resort, St. Lucia
  • Carnival Corporation & plc
  • Tropical Shipping
  • Wyndham Grand Barbados, Sam Lord’s Castle All-Inclusive Resort
  • Comfort Suites Paradise Island, Bahamas

Celebrating Culture and Leadership

Attendees were treated to an inspiring evening filled with cultural performances and dynamic exchanges, showcasing the best of the Caribbean’s heritage and potential. The awards honored visionaries whose contributions continue to elevate the region’s tourism, media, and sustainability sectors.

ADVERTISEMENT

The CMEx Caribbean Leadership Awards 2024 not only recognized excellence but also fostered collaboration and innovation, ensuring a brighter future for the Caribbean and its people.
